Car
If you are driving from the center of Fa'asaleleaga, head south on the main road towards Savaia. Follow the signs directing you to Savaia. The drive will take approximately 15-20 minutes. As you approach Savaia, keep an eye out for signs for the Giant Clam Sanctuary, which will be located near the coast. Once you arrive, there is parking available near the sanctuary entrance.
Public Transportation
To reach the Giant Clam Sanctuary via public transportation, look for a local bus heading towards Savaia. The bus ride should take about 30-40 minutes depending on stops. Make sure to confirm with the driver that they stop near the Giant Clam Sanctuary. Once you arrive in Savaia, it may be necessary to walk a short distance to the sanctuary, so be prepared for a brief stroll. It’s advisable to carry some cash (around 5-10 WST) for the bus fare.
Taxi
If you prefer a more direct route, you can hire a taxi from anywhere in Fa'asaleleaga. Simply inform the driver you want to go to the Giant Clam Sanctuary in Savaia. The taxi ride will take about 20 minutes, and the fare should be around 30-50 WST depending on your starting location. Confirm the fare before starting your journey.
